The Digital Overload Dilemma



When touchscreens first began taking over dashboards, they seemed like the future: tidy, customizable, and packed with functions. They removed mess and allowed automakers to enhance their insides with less physical parts. However as even more attributes were hidden within electronic food selections, drivers began to voice issues.



Touchscreens commonly need numerous steps to execute basic jobs like changing the environment or transforming the radio terminal. Unlike buttons, they do not have the user-friendly muscle memory that permits a driver to alter a setting without taking their eyes off the road. With a lot occurring on-screen, it comes to be all too simple to get sidetracked-- something no one wants when taking a trip at highway speeds.



The Return of Tactile Functionality



Among the biggest benefits of switches is their responsive responses. You can feel them without requiring to look. This sensory support makes them not simply hassle-free but much safer for motorists. When your hand naturally knows where the quantity handle is or just how much to press a button to activate the defrost, it lowers the need to glance down or away from the road. And while touchscreens offer ease for infotainment and navigating, the essential everyday features-- like danger lights, audio controls, and HVAC-- feel much better fit to physical controls.



As a matter of fact, several chauffeurs that previously advocated electronic systems have actually revealed appreciation for more recent designs that blend contemporary visual appeals with the practical feeling of typical controls. It's not concerning denying innovation-- it's concerning enhancing functionality.



A Balanced Design Philosophy



Developers have actually noticed this moving belief. Rather than abandoning displays, they're reassessing just how they're incorporated. The best insides now strike a balance between digital convenience and analog accuracy. That implies purposefully placing buttons for essential functions while making use of digital user interfaces for apps, navigation, and media.



This hybrid strategy is particularly prominent in automobiles developed for long-distance driving or family members. The simplicity of pushing a button without screwing up through a food selection makes a huge difference when you're trying to remain focused, comfy, and secure. Also in automobiles understood for innovative technology, a simple rotating dial or responsive control can be the function that wins over chauffeurs trying to find thoughtful design.
